生成点文件以可视化权杖环境
sceptre-dot的Python项目详细描述
帮助您用Graphviz(点)可视化您的权杖项目。
优点
- 可视化可以作为文档人工制品添加到项目中
- 具有许多显式/隐式依赖关系会减慢部署速度。使用生成的依赖关系图快速发现由这些依赖关系造成的瓶颈。
安装
按照official instuctions为操作系统安装graphviz。
在安装sceptre的同一个python解释器(virtualenv)中安装此包,以便其python库已经可用:
pip install sceptre-dot
用法
在通常调用sceptre launch -y $YOUR_PATH
的同一目录中,运行:
sceptre-dot $YOUR_PATH > output.dot fdp -Tpng output.dot -o output.png # use fdp engine for best results
根据简化的BSD许可证发布。